ABOUT TRAFALGAR ENTERTAINMENT (TE)

Co-founded by Sir Howard Panter and Dame Rosemary Squire in 2017, Trafalgar Entertainment is a premium international live entertainment business focussed on new productions, venue ownership, Performing Arts education, theatre ticketing, the distribution of live-streaming innovative content and the provision of great theatres where people can come together to share in the experience of live entertainment. TE is home to Trafalgar Theatres, The Chiswick Cinema, Trafalgar Theatre Productions, Trafalgar Releasing, Trafalgar Tickets, Stagecoach Performing Arts, Drama Kids/Helen O'Grady Drama Academy, ticketing company London Theatre Direct, Stagedoor, Jonathan Church Theatre Productions, and Imagine Theatre.

We are passionate about entertainment, audiences, and the live experience and we value Creativity, Collaboration, Excellence and Respect.

ABOUT TRAFALGAR TICKETS

Trafalgar Tickets was created in 2021 with the primary objective of creating a consumer ticketing brand for our venues. We welcome 2 million patrons to our regional venues annually, offering a varied program of world-class live entertainment. Trafalgar Tickets will become the leading ticketing service in its class with customer centricity at its heart, whilst creating unique value propositions for our clients and partners.

The ticketing division also includes London's premier ticket agency: London Theatre Direct. With over 20 years of leading the market in innovation and creativity, we serve 2 million customers annually through our best-in-market technology solutions and unrivalled inventory access.

ABOUT THIS ROLE

Trafalgar Tickets is seeking a dynamic Social Media & Content Executive to execute the social media and content strategy for Trafalgar Tickets and all our ticketing assets, including venues and our agency brands.

The role will join us at a pivotal phase of transformation, involving the creation and delivery of the digital content strategy. The Social Media & Content Executive reports to our Social Media & Content Manager and will primarily work for our ticket agent brand, London Theatre Direct.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Creation of written and visual content, including, but not limited to, landing pages, product detail pages, email content, SEO, newsletters, editorial, interviews, search and social advertisement copy, audio and video content
  • Schedule and develop organic content in line with the strategy for our London ticket agent brands, which will be across various channels, including social media and self-hosted content
  • Social media community management across all our platforms
  • Population of social media and content ideation documents
  • Execution of the content calendar to deliver effective and data-driven organic content to support our brands, products and producing partners
  • Influencer coordination to include strategy execution across TikTok and Instagram, influencer outreach and communication, attending influencer nights and reporting
  • Creation of reporting and insights for influencers, social media and SEO to optimise engagement and performance on content output
  • The creation and manipulation of digital assets, including images, video, animation and audio
  • Collaborating with third-party agencies/partners in the delivery of the team's objectives
  • Liaising with wider marketing teams to produce relevant, compelling & engaging content
  • Always acting in accordance with Trafalgar Entertainment's values and ethics
  • Any other ad-hoc duties as required

ABOUT YOU

  • You have excellent copywriting skills (short and long form) and written English
  • You have meticulous attention to detail, with an overall passion for continual improvement
  • You will have experience creating brilliant content across a variety of channels
  • Ideally, you will have experience dealing with influencers, negotiating commercials and working with them to create exciting, bespoke content
  • You are proficient with design and any relevant design software
  • You have experience in creating short-form video content for various channels
  • Experience working collaboratively within a team and across multiple departments
  • You have a fundamental understanding of managing social media channels and content optimisation strategies
  • Ideally, you will have a working knowledge of SEO, although this is preferred and not mandatory
